Sunflower Oil: Understanding Purified and Natural Selections

Sunflower oil, a widely used cooking fat , presents buyers with a key choice : refined versus unrefined. Refined sunflower oil undergoes a thorough sequence of purifying steps, including bleaching and odor stripping, to yield a pale liquid with a neutral essence. Conversely, unrefined sunflower oil, sometimes called "cold-pressed," retains more of the inherent nutrients and natural taste , although it may exhibit a a little earthier taste and a cloudier color. Ultimately, the ideal version relies on personal desires and intended applications .

Examining Oil Processing : A Guide to Soybean and Sun

The procedure of refining soybean and sun vegetable is a sophisticated undertaking , transforming crude seeds into the familiar culinary plant we use . Initially , the seeds are prepared and broken to release the lipid-rich kernels. Subsequently , these kernels undergo separation – typically through a solvent method using chemicals for soy and mechanical crushing for both varieties of vegetable . The obtained oil is then exposed to a series of refinements , including gum removal, pH balancing, bleaching , and deodorization .

  • Gum removal removes phospholipids which can result in haziness.
  • Acid removal eliminates fatty acids that add to degradation.
  • Decolorization clarifies the appearance of the oil .
  • Deodorization gets rid of undesirable scents.
